CA AB2101
Bill
AI Summary
-
Authorizes courts to order, as a condition of probation, that persons convicted of prohibited voter registration activities be prohibited from receiving money or other consideration for assisting others to register to vote.
-
Authorizes courts to order, as a condition of probation, that persons convicted of violating initiative, referendum, or recall petition circulation laws be prohibited from receiving money or other consideration for gathering signatures on such petitions.
-
Adds Section 18112 to the Elections Code to implement voter registration payment prohibitions and Section 18604 to implement petition signature gathering payment prohibitions.
-
Approved by Governor on September 25, 2010 and chaptered as Chapter 372.
